Sreten Bozic was a Yugoslavian anthropologist and author who specialized in Australian aboriginal history.
He arrived in Australia in 1960. [1]
He wrote several books under the name B Wongar implying that he was a Australian Aborigine. It was only 1981 that he was revealed as a Yugoslavian anthropologist.[2] [3]
